Assessment and Mitigation
When we arrive, our technicians will quickly assess the situation and get to work extracting the water. We’ll use specialized equipment like truck-mounted pumps and wet vacuums to get the water out as quickly as possible. This step is critical in preventing further damage and getting your property back to normal.
Water Extraction
Once we’ve assessed the situation, we’ll start the water extraction process. This may involve using a wet vacuum to remove standing water, or a truck-mounted pump to extract water from the affected area. Our team will work carefully to avoid causing further damage and to get the water out as quickly as possible.
Structural Drying
After the water has been extracted, we’ll begin the structural drying process. This involves using specialized equipment to dry out the affected area, including dehumidifiers and air movers. Our team will work carefully to ensure that the area is completely dry and free of moisture.
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Once the area is dry, we’ll sanitize and disinfect the affected area to prevent any potential health risks. This involves using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ure that the area is completely safe and free of bacteria and other contaminants.
Final Inspection and Completion
Once the sanitizing and disinfecting process is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ure that the area is completely dry and free of moisture. We’ll also complete any necessary repairs and replacements, and provide you with a final report on the work that was done.

Pool Leak Water Removal Cost in Federal Way, WA
The cost of pool le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Federal Way, WA.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services related to pool leak water removal: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Mitigation |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of leak, size of affected area, local conditions |
| Water Extraction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Amount of water, equipment needed, labor costs |
| Structural Drying |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, labor costs |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, labor costs |
| Final Inspection and Completion |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, labor costs |
